Order processing & distribution

  • Orders pulled in from every channel automatically.
  • Automated EDI order processing.
  • Rule-based order confirmation and routing.
  • Smart order triage by urgency and SLA.
  • Live order status via self-service portal.
  • Duplicate order detection before it becomes a problem.
  • Priority queue management during peak periods.

Order delivery management

  • Delivery priority rules you define — enforced automatically.
  • Accurate delivery time estimates for pre-orders and backorders.
  • Auto-generated pick and pack lists with SKUs and specs.
  • Smart carrier assignment with default carrier locking.
  • Real-time delivery tracking for ops teams and customers.
  • Exception alerts when a delivery window is at risk.

Payment processing

  • Built-in connections to PayPal, Stripe, Braintree, and more.
  • Full payment data encryption at every step.
  • Support for multiple currencies and payment types.
  • Template-based invoice generation on order confirmation.
  • Refund processing tied to your return policy rules.
  • Auto-filled checkout to reduce cart abandonment.

Customer self-service portal

  • Full order history across every channel in one account.
  • Live delivery tracking without calling support.
  • Request submission for re-orders, returns, and repairs.
  • Automated notifications at every key order milestone.
  • For B2B: invoice overview, approval workflows, and sub-accounts.

Return & warranty management

  • Return and exchange requests from any channel or portal.
  • Automated verification against your return policy rules.
  • Auto-linking of return requests to original sales orders.
  • Refund amount calculated automatically by policy.
  • Full return tracking from customer to warehouse.
  • Warranty claim management with status updates to customer.

Analytics & reporting

  • Custom dashboards for sales, fulfillment, and service teams.
  • KPI tracking: fill rate, orders per day, carrier performance.
  • Demand forecasting from historical and live sales data.
  • Scheduled and exportable reports — no manual pulling.
  • Bottleneck detection before fulfillment delays pile up.

Ways to Set Up Automated Ordering & Platforms We Recommend

There are three main approaches to setting up automated ordering. The right fit depends on your business complexity, budget, and how unique your fulfillment workflows are.

B
Business automation platforms

All-in-one platforms with an ordering module as part of a broader suite. Unified environment across your whole operation, but high subscription costs and features you may not need.

S
Off-the-shelf ordering software

Ready-made tools covering order aggregation, processing, and fulfillment tracking. Faster to deploy and lower upfront cost, but fixed features that are hard to customize as your business evolves.

C
Custom ordering system — $200K–$400K+

Built from the ground up around your specific channels, rules, and integrations. Nothing more, nothing less. Built to grow with you. Best ROI for businesses with complex or unique fulfillment workflows.

Platforms We Recommend

When a platform-based approach fits your situation, these are the ones our team works with most — chosen for their real-world performance, not marketing promises.

Magento Order Management

Known for its clean UI and flexible fulfillment workflow support including in-store options. Built-in BI reporting on orders, shipments, returns, and payments. Best for mid-sized and growing businesses.

IBM Sterling Order Management

Enterprise-grade platform with a powerful rules engine and full order lifecycle support. Proven at scale across large enterprise operations with complex fulfillment scenarios.

Oracle NetSuite Order Management

Solid for mid-sized businesses needing automated fulfillment without heavy custom development. Custom automation triggers configurable from the UI — no coding needed.
